Output 10617d8325f94883de9f0ae3bfc75c1c463ccbaa58d08c59e6fd6a26e0c52e46:0

value
1491460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8c87a45ce28a957f25c1464640417b1cd720e8 OP_EQUAL
address
38VCGvaCupjyGS9iQC6kB1dqREkRRyQx7v
transaction
10617d8325f94883de9f0ae3bfc75c1c463ccbaa58d08c59e6fd6a26e0c52e46
spent
true